FCC To Address Video Accessibility at Nov. Meeting, Wheeler Says

The FCC will make it easier for the blind and visually impaired to access video programming on multiple devices, at its Nov. 19 meeting, said FCC Chairman Tom Wheeler in a blog post Thursday. Speaking of a second report and…
